DWI Clients -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ation Programs - Marne, MI.

DWI clients in rehab need specific requirements met to satisfy the terms of their court sentencing. Treatment programs which help fulfill these court requirements and conditions, which are usually far more lenient than traditional sentencing which would include large fines and incarceration, are available in Marne to provide educational services, counseling, and additional assessment for serious alcohol or drug issues.

Education is an essential tool used at rehab programs catering to DWI clients. There are different levels of alcohol education classes which can vary by state. Level I education classes normally include 12 hours of education about the effects of alcohol and drugs. This is the what a person with a first conviction or someone under 21 will ordinarily be required to complete. Level II classes would consist of both education and group therapy in a program which is approved by the courts. How long a person will have to participate in therapy depends upon a few considerations, which can be, for example, the number of DWI's the person has had, and the severity of the violation. Ordinarily, individuals will be required to take the Level II DWI classes and therapy unless their blood-alcohol content level was extremely low when they were stopped and there were no other serious charges when the person was arrested.
